Maison >base de données >SQL >Quelles sont les fonctions d'agrégation couramment utilisées en SQL ?

Quelles sont les fonctions d'agrégation couramment utilisées en SQL ?

下次还敢
下次还敢original
2024-05-07 05:54:161277parcourir

Les fonctions d'agrégation en SQL sont utilisées pour combiner plusieurs valeurs. Les fonctions couramment utilisées sont : SUM() pour la somme, AVG() pour la valeur moyenne, MIN() pour la valeur minimale, MAX() pour la valeur maximale et COUNT() pour la valeur maximale. count , DISTINCT COUNT() pour trouver des comptes uniques, TOTAL() pour trouver la somme dans une partition, AVERAGE() pour trouver la valeur moyenne dans une partition, BIT_AND() pour trouver le AND au niveau du bit, BIT_OR() pour trouver le OR au niveau du bit, GREATEST() pour trouver la valeur maximale, LEAST( ) pour trouver la valeur minimale.

Quelles sont les fonctions d'agrégation couramment utilisées en SQL ?

Fonctions d'agrégation dans SQL

Les fonctions d'agrégation sont utilisées pour combiner plusieurs valeurs d'un ensemble de données en une seule valeur. Les fonctions d'agrégation couramment utilisées en SQL incluent :

1. Fonction Somme : SUM()

  • Calcule la somme de toutes les valeurs de l'ensemble de données.

2. Fonction moyenne : AVG()

  • Calculez la moyenne de toutes les valeurs de l'ensemble de données.

3. Recherchez la fonction de valeur minimale : MIN()

  • Renvoie la valeur minimale dans l'ensemble de données.

4. Fonction de recherche de valeur maximale : MAX()

  • Renvoie la valeur maximale dans l'ensemble de données.

5. Trouvez la fonction de comptage : COUNT()

  • Calculez le nombre d'enregistrements dans l'ensemble de données.

6. Recherchez la fonction de comptage unique : DISTINCT COUNT()

  • Calculez le nombre de valeurs uniques dans l'ensemble de données.

7. Fonction Total : TOTAL()

  • Calculez la somme de toutes les valeurs d'une partition.

8. Fonction moyenne : MOYENNE()

  • Calculez la moyenne de toutes les valeurs d'une partition.

9. Recherchez la fonction de somme au niveau du bit : BIT_AND()

  • Effectue une opération ET au niveau du bit sur les nombres de l'ensemble de données et renvoie le ET au niveau du bit du résultat.

10. Trouvez la fonction OU au niveau du bit : BIT_OR()

  • Effectuez une opération OU au niveau du bit sur les nombres de l'ensemble de données et renvoyez le OU au niveau du bit du résultat.

11. Fonction maximale : GREATEST()

  • Renvoie le maximum de deux valeurs ou plus.

12. Fonction minimum : LEAST()

  • Renvoie le minimum de deux valeurs ou plus.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n